4895 Texas Ave
Reno, Nevada 89506

The world's fastest motorsport.

Official Website: http://airrace.org

Added by gid on March 1, 2008

Comments

Cobra Ray

Well Ramp Rats! I may make it This Year!!! Go Online Yall,,,Cobra Ray.